  1. BRIGHAM YOUNG UNIVERSITY (BYU):

BYUBrigham young university is a non-profit university that is founded, supported, and guided by The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ints.

The sole aim is to assist individuals in their quest for perfection and eternal life. For this reason, the tuition fees are subsidized with the tithes paid by church members. The estimated tuition for non-Later-day Saints undergraduate students is about $11,940, graduate $15,020.

  1. TRUMAN STATE UNIVERSITY

TRUMAN STATE UNIVERSITYThis is a public university with a unique kind of arts and science curricula. It offers room for active learning and it is ranked 9th most affordable in-state public university. This is why we have included it on our list of cheapest universities in the US for international students.

Here, active learning environments meet intellectually curious students. The estimated tuition fees for international undergraduate students is about $15,000.

  1. FLORIDA STATE UNIVERSITY

FLORIDA STATE UNIVERSITYThis is one of the US elite research institutes, with broad knowledge dissemination in sciences, arts, technology, and humanities. It was established in 1851 with over 297-degree programs ranging from bachelor’s, master’s, doctoral, etc.

As one of the cheapest universities in the US for international students, The FSU has its tuition ranging from $18,799 for fresh undergraduate students to $20,043 for graduates. See full details here

  1. BINGHAMTON UNIVERSITY

BINGHAMTON UNIVERSITYThis is a public research University in Vestal NY. It gives room for outdoor sports and is one of the cheapest US colleges. Students from more than 100 countries choose Binghamton because they know it’s one of few American universities that emphasize meaningful cultural and intellectual exchange.

The tuition is about $24,660 for international undergraduate students. See the full estimated bill for international students.
